Dentsu extends search alliance

Dentsu and US online ad technology firm 24/7 Real Media have unveiled plans to roll out the search engine marketing JV they founded last year in Japan to key markets across Asia.

The partners listed China, South Korea, Taiwan, Thailand and India as priority markets, but will assess the potential profitability of each market before setting up shop.

Dentsu will help set up each new local subsidiary and offer operational support while 24/7 Real Media will license its Decide DNA technology to each office. Initially, the two companies are looking to establish a jointly-owned holding company, provisionally called Dentsu 24/7 Search Holdings, within the next two weeks, to oversee the rollout.
